Robbery – Public Assistance Requested: C19-200156
On August 26, 2019, at approximately 7:50 a.m., a 39-year-old male was walking in the 500 block of Portage Avenue when he was approached from behind by a male who attempted to rob him of his wallet.
The male then brandished a large knife and ran up to the victim in a threatening manner. The victim was pushed up against a wall at which time a struggle ensued, and the male fled on foot. No injuries were reported, and the victim did not lose any property.
Members of the Major Crimes Unit continued with the investigation and are requesting the public’s help with identifying a suspect. The suspect is described as an Indigenous male in appearance, in his 20’s, approximately 5’10” in height, with a skinny build and black hair. He was wearing a black hoodie, dark blue pants and a black hat.
